| /** |
| * Called when the network first begins to establish the call session and is now connecting |
| * to the remote party. This must be called once after {@link ImsCallSessionImplBase#start} and |
| * before any other method on this listener. After this is called, |
| * {@link #callSessionProgressing(ImsStreamMediaProfile)} must be called to communicate any |
| * further updates. |
| * <p/> |
| * Once this is called, {@link #callSessionTerminated} must be called |
| * to end the call session. In the event that the session failed before the remote party |
| * was contacted, {@link #callSessionInitiatingFailed} must be called. |
| * |
| * @param profile the associated {@link ImsCallProfile}. |
| */ |
| public void callSessionInitiating(@NonNull ImsCallProfile profile) { |
| try { |
| mListener.callSessionInitiating(profile); |
| } catch (RemoteException e) { |
| e.rethrowFromSystemServer(); |
| } |
| } |

| /** |
| * The {@link ImsService} calls this method to inform the framework of a DTMF digit which was |
| * received from the network. |
| * <p> |
| * According to <a href="http://tools.ietf.org/html/rfc2833">RFC 2833 sec 3.10</a>, |
| * event 0 ~ 9 maps to decimal value 0 ~ 9, '*' to 10, '#' to 11, event 'A' ~ 'D' to 12 ~ 15. |
| * <p> |
| * <em>Note:</em> Alpha DTMF digits are converted from lower-case to upper-case. |
| * |
| * @param dtmf The DTMF digit received, '0'-'9', *, #, A, B, C, or D. |
| * @throws IllegalArgumentException If an invalid DTMF character is provided. |
| */ |
| public void callSessionDtmfReceived(char dtmf) { |
| if (!(dtmf >= '0' && dtmf <= '9' |
| || dtmf >= 'A' && dtmf <= 'D' |
| || dtmf >= 'a' && dtmf <= 'd' |
| || dtmf == '*' |
| || dtmf == '#')) { |
| throw new IllegalArgumentException("DTMF digit must be 0-9, *, #, A, B, C, D"); |
| } |
| try { |
| mListener.callSessionDtmfReceived(Character.toUpperCase(dtmf)); |
| } catch (RemoteException e) { |
| e.rethrowFromSystemServer(); |
| } |
| } |
| |
| /** |
| * The {@link ImsService} calls this method to inform the framework of RTP header extension data |
| * which was received from the network. |
| * <p> |
| * The set of {@link RtpHeaderExtension} data are identified by local identifiers which were |
| * negotiated during SDP signalling. See RFC8285, |
| * {@link ImsCallProfile#getAcceptedRtpHeaderExtensionTypes()} and |
| * {@link RtpHeaderExtensionType} for more information. |
| * <p> |
| * By specification, the RTP header extension is an unacknowledged transmission and there is no |
| * guarantee that the header extension will be delivered by the network to the other end of the |
| * call. |
| * |
| * @param extensions The RTP header extension data received. |
| */ |
| public void callSessionRtpHeaderExtensionsReceived( |
| @NonNull Set<RtpHeaderExtension> extensions) { |
| Objects.requireNonNull(extensions, "extensions are required."); |
| try { |
| mListener.callSessionRtpHeaderExtensionsReceived( |
| new ArrayList<RtpHeaderExtension>(extensions)); |
| } catch (RemoteException e) { |
| e.rethrowFromSystemServer(); |
| } |
| } |
